Intro
The Metabo WPB 12-125 Quick is a powerful and versatile angle grinder that is perfect for a variety of tasks. It features a 1200W motor that delivers up to 11,000rpm, making it ideal for cutting, grinding, and polishing a wide range of materials. The WPB 12-125 Quick also features a number of ergonomic features that make it comfortable to use for extended periods of time, including a soft-grip handle and a vibration-reducing system.

Features
The Metabo WPB 12-125 Quick has a number of features that make it a versatile and user-friendly tool. These features include:
- Quick-change disc system: The WPB 12-125 Quick features Metabo's M-Quick quick-change disc system, which allows you to change discs in seconds without the need for tools.
- Dust extraction port: The WPB 12-125 Quick has a dust extraction port that allows you to connect a dust extractor to help keep your work area clean.
- Vibration-reducing system: The WPB 12-125 Quick features Metabo's Vibration Control system, which helps to reduce vibration and fatigue.
- Soft-grip handle: The WPB 12-125 Quick has a soft-grip handle that provides a comfortable and secure grip.

Here are some additional thoughts I have about the Metabo WPB 12-125:
- The variable speed control is a great feature that allows you to adjust the speed of the grinder to the specific task at hand. This can help to prevent damage to the workpiece and to the grinder itself.
- The restart safety feature is a must-have for any angle grinder. This feature prevents the grinder from starting up unexpectedly after it has been turned off. This can help to prevent accidents, especially if the grinder is dropped or bumped.
- The disc brake is another important safety feature. This feature helps to stop the disc from spinning immediately after the grinder is turned off. This can help to prevent injuries if the grinder comes into contact with your skin.
